Crafting a Standout Social Media Manager Summary
Your summary is the first thing recruiters see. Here are examples that actually work for senior social media managers:
“VP Social Media with 10 years building global social presence. Leads 30-person team across 40 markets, manages $20M budget, and drives 1B+ annual impressions.”
“Chief Digital Officer with 8 years transforming brand's digital presence. Built organization from 5 to 25, led digital transformation, and drove 100% audience growth.”
“Global Head of Social with 12 years at Fortune 500. Manages social across 100+ markets, leads 50-person team, and drives brand valued at $10B+.”
“SVP Communications with 9 years leading integrated social and PR. Manages 40-person team, $30M budget, and guides brand through major reputation events.”

Common Mistakes Social Media Managers Make
❌ Mistake
Resume focuses on social tactics
✓ Fix
At executive level, show organizational leadership: teams built globally, brand value protected, strategy defined.
❌ Mistake
No crisis leadership evidence
✓ Fix
Senior social leaders guide brands through crises. Show you've led through high-stakes moments.
❌ Mistake
Missing brand value contribution
✓ Fix
Connect social to brand value: reputation protected, awareness built, audience relationships developed.

Frequently Asked Questions
What's the path from social to CMO?
VP Social → CMO or Chief Digital Officer. Show you can lead broader marketing and brand strategy.
Is Chief Digital Officer a good next step?
Yes. CDO often encompasses social plus digital marketing, product, and technology.
How important is global experience?
For Fortune 500 roles, critical. Show you can lead across cultures and markets.
Should I consider board positions?
Yes. Digital and social expertise is valued on boards. It expands perspective and network.
